The Temple Intrigue Andrew Mcdearmid
The Temple Intrigue
Andrew Mcdearmid
The Sikhs won the freedom from Muslim rule and in three wars fought the British to a standstill before becoming their alley. When India and Pakistan were given their freedom the Sikhs lost half of their state. When India further subdivided their domain the Sikhs demanded a return of land and home rule. Phillip Williams a young C. I. A. agent finds himself almost at the center of the resulting struggle.
